Notes pratiques que j'utilise régulièrement. Plutôt que de tout chercher à nouveau à chaque fois, je centralise ici.
□ 1. Créer /opt/appdata/<service>/
□ 2. Écrire docker-compose.yml
â–ˇ 3. Configurer les variables .env
â–ˇ 4. Lancer : docker compose up -d
□ 5. Tester l'accès interne
â–ˇ 6. Ajouter dans NPM (Proxy Host + SSL)
□ 7. Protéger avec Authelia si besoin
â–ˇ 8. Ajouter dans Uptime Kuma
â–ˇ 9. Ajouter dans Homepage
â–ˇ 10. Documenter dans le wiki
docker logs <nom_container> --tail=100
docker events --since 1h
cd /opt/appdata/<service> && docker compose down && docker compose up -d
systemctl restart wazuh-agent
journalctl -u wazuh-agent -n 50
/var/ossec/bin/agent-auth -m <IP_MANAGER_WAZUH>
Ça arrive quand je teste des trucs depuis mon propre réseau.
docker exec crowdsec cscli decisions list --ip 192.168.1.x
docker exec crowdsec cscli decisions delete --ip 192.168.1.x
ssh -p 2222 root@192.168.1.169 # SSH Proxmox
pct exec 108 -- bash # Entrer dans LXC 108
pct list && qm list # Inventaire complet
docker stats --no-stream # Ressources containers
df -h # Espace disque